NEAGEP Workshop Looks Beyond GREs for STEM Students
October 03, 2017
AMHERST, Mass., Oct. 3 -- The University of Massachusetts's Amherst campus issued the following news:

The Northeast Alliance for Graduate Education and the Professoriate (NEAGEP), a long-standing 15-institution alliance led by Sandra Petersen, veterinary and animal sciences, recently sponsored a workshop "If Not GRE, Then What?" aimed at developing better predictors of graduate academic success in STEM fields.

The workshop was held on campus Sept. 25-26 . . .
